Open Wide: A Girl’s Guide To Unashamed Sex
“I was always brought up to be modest. In our house we never walked around naked. I don’t think I ever saw my mother without any clothes on. She always locked the bathroom door and never appeared without a robe. I found the idea of being naked with a boy was nerve-wracking enough. But the idea of opening up my legs and letting him look at me … well, it was out of the question.”
That was Frannie, twenty-one, from Tarry town, New York, who originally wrote to me about what she supposed was her “frigidity.” In fact, she had a very strong sex drive; Her only problem was that she lacked sexual knowledge and technique; and without that knowledge and technique, she naturally lacked confidence.
She was embarrassed about showing herself, not just because she’d never shown herself to anybody before—not her husband or the two boyfriends with whom she’d slept before meeting him—but because she was concerned that her husband would think her a whore.
But no sexual relationship can be widened or improved unless you’re both familiar with each other’s sexual organs and frequently enjoy the sight, the feel, the taste, and the aroma of them. Aroma? I can hear some of you ask, nervously. Well, yes, for sure. Your vulva odor, the so-called cassolette, contains powerful chemicals that can arouse in men a tremendously strong sexual response.
Of course you should always keep yourself clean. But immediately prior to making love, you should never wash away all of those natural chemicals with perfumed soap or vaginal douches. You may think that you’re making your private parts smell as sweet as a rose, but in fact you’re not doing yourself any favors at all. Men are naturally and irresistibly attracted to the smell of your vulva; and as part of sexual foreplay, bodily kisses lead steadily and inexorably toward your genital area.
If you’ve been brought up to regard nudity as embarrassing and your sexual parts as something you’d rather not discuss, let alone stare at—let alone allow your lover to stare at—then of course it’s not your fault. But if you want to take that Great Leap Forward in your sex life, then you’re going to have to grit your teeth and open yourself up, regardless.
Remember what I said before about your vulva. It’s yours, it’s individual, but it’s beautiful—and in your lover’s eyes it’s absolutely the most entrancing sight in the entire universe. Before your Mutual Discovery Session, you should have taken the opportunity to look through as many men’s magazines as possible, just to get yourself used to the sight of women with their legs open, showing off their vulvas, and to the variety of different vulvas there are.
You may disapprove of women opening up their legs for magazines. But whatever your objections, you, unlike them, won’t be exposing yourself in public. You’ll be exposing yourself only for your lover, to show how much you adore him, to show how close you want to be to him.
